Other top prospect performances:

Orioles RHP Kevin Gausman, Triple-A Norfolk: 5 IP, 4 H, 2 BB, 4 K — Gausman was working around 96 mph early in the start, his best since tossing 4 2/3 scoreless in his first start. The 23-year-old hurler has a 3.24 ERA, 15/10 K/BB through 16 2/3 innings.

Phillies 3B Maikel Franco, Triple-A Lehigh Valley: 3-for-5, 2B, 2 R, 2 RBI — A breakout performance for Franco, who looked lost at the plate just last week — in a doubleheader last Thursday, he chased numerous breaking balls off the plate and got beat a few times by inside fastballs from Aaron Laffey, who tops out in the upper 80s. Franco had the day off Friday, went 0-for-4 Saturday, but may have figured something out Sunday.

[milbvideo id=”32259647" width=”480" height=”270" /]

Marlins LHP Adam Conley, Triple-A New Orleans: 7 IP, 2 H, R, BB, 8 K — Conley was nearly as good as Friedrich in PCL pitcher’s duel. The 23-year-old has 25 strikeouts and seven walks through 22 1/3 innings this season.

Braves 2B Tommy La Stella, Triple-A Gwinnett: 3-for-5, 2B, 2 R, 2 RBI — La Stella is hitting .327 with a 3/7 K/BB through 14 games. Dan Uggla, meanwhile, is hitting .234 for Atlanta, which seems pertinent.

Cardinals OF Oscar Taveras, Triple-A Memphis: 2-for-4, 2B, RBI, R, BB, K — The Cardinals top prospect delivered a walk-off double in the ninth.

[milbvideo id=”32254481" width=”480" height=”270" /]

Marlins LHP Andrew Heaney, Double-A Jacksonville: 7 IP, 3 H, ER, 9 K — Another stellar outing for the 22-year-old, as he’s allowed just one earned run over his past three starts. Heaney’s ERA is at 1.48 through four starts and his K/BB is at 25/3 through 14 1/3 frames.

White Sox SS Tim Anderson, Class A Advanced Winston-Salem: 3-for-5, HR, 3 RBI, 2 R — The second pro home run and first in full-season ball for last year’s first-round pick. The 20-year-old is slashing .281/.309/.516 through 16 Carolina League contests.

White Sox OF Courtney Hawkins, Class A Advanced Winston-Salem: 3-for-5, HR 3 RBI, R — He’s still striking out too much (20 times in 17 games), but the contact Hawkins is making is much louder, helping him rack up five homers and a .625 slugging percentage through 17 contests in his repeat of the Carolina League.
